Baby’s Got Her Bluejeans On was recorded by country music artist Mel McDaniel and released in October 1984. In February 1985 this song was a number-one hit on the U.S. Billboards Hot Country Songs.  Baby’s Got Her Bluejeans on was Mel’s only number-one single.
